What Is The Story?

Jack and the Beanstalk gets a fresh, frothy makeover in this udderly ridiculous retelling set right here in Islington. Jack's a young milkman helping out on his mum's struggling dairy, just off Udder Street. Times are tough, and with the last cow giving up the ghost, Jack is sent to market to sell her off and save the farm. But instead of coming back with hard cash, Jack returns with nothing but a handful of so-called magic beans. His mum is furious and flings them out the window, but that night something incredible happens: a towering beanstalk bursts through the pavement, stretching high above the North London skyline. Up Jack climbs, whipped cream canister at the ready, and finds himself in the sky-high lair of a not-so-friendly Giant! With Islington in danger, expect laughs, boos, cheers, and a few cries of "he's behind you!". Perfect for kids and big kids alike!
